Colorful Server Rack Icon: Data Storage, Networking, and IT Infrastructure
Schlüsselwörter
server,
data storage,
networking,
computer,
technology,
hosting,
database,
network,
system,
connection,
hardware,
storage,
cyberspace,
server room,
computing,
infrastructure,
information